We’ve seen a lot of successes over the years, but what is one you are most proud of?

The solution we implemented and the savings realized from the work we did for Syncrude’s Mobile Events Synthesis (MEES):

Syncrude has collected data from haul trucks since the mid-1990s. Prior to implementing their (MEES) solution, business stakeholders still used spreadsheets to analyze large sets of truck data. Syncrude and Dexcent’s goal of the MEES solution was to create an automation system that would leverage mobile equipment monitoring, predictive information, OT integration, and a reliability knowledge base to generate near real-time information that could be integrated with workflows to improve equipment uptime and reduce maintenance costs.

The results were outstanding; Syncrude calculated that operating savings came to $16.75 per hour per unit, which equates to a $20 million annual operating cost avoidance, not including lost production hours that would have accrued. From a safety perspective, monitoring dumping procedures improved compliance and reduced non-procedural operating dumping incidents by 85% in the first month.

What are some of the biggest challenges our customers face?

With the current economic changes/challenges in Alberta today, all of our customers face major cost reductions of their plant operation budgets and want to see a significant increase in productivity.

The second challenge is Cyber Security for most organizations – more so organizations that rely on Operational Technology (OT) to operate their industrial and infrastructure processes. The rising security risk to industrial control systems and emerging compliance obligations place increasing demands on affected organizations to assess and improve their Cyber Security posture.
